EXCHANGE FERTILIZER (PHOSPHATE ROCK PLUS AMMONIUM-ZEOLITE) EFFECTS ON SORGHUM SUDANGRASS

The effectiveness of one NH4-exchanged zeolite (clinoptilolite) in increasing phosphate-rock solubility in Red Feather loamy sand, a Lithic Cryoboralf and Weld loam, an Aridic Paleustoll, was evaluated by measuring increases in dry matter, nutrient content, and nutrient uptake by Sorghum bicolor and S. sudanense. The exchanger fertilizer system increased P availability in the Weld soil by producing lower soil pH (nitrification of NH4 released by the zeolite) than the 0:1 zeolite/phosphate-rock ratio control and by adsorption of Ca in the zeolite. The Red Feather soil, deficient in K, did not provide definite yield responses because the zeolite sequestered K, thereby reducing plant K concentrations and uptake even though the zeolite increased total P uptake. -from Authors
